Synopsis
Short volleyball player Souta must overcome self-doubt to win teammate Asahi's heart and reclaim his passion.
Souta Suzuki, a high school boy on the school volleyball team, is interested in his classmate Asahi Shinonome, a member of the girls' volleyball team. She thought of him as a good volleyball player, so she has been seeking him out every day. Souta was a keen volleyball player until junior high. However, because of his height, he could never become the spiker he longed to be. As a result, he got into the habit of giving up on things. Souta's high school life: Will he meekly accept what he cannot have? Or will he try to become a man who can stand with Asahi? Youth is a series of choices. Please, Souta, hang in there and do your best! (Source: Shogakukan, translated)
